      The Billing Specialist I is responsible for delivering the best invoicing experience possible to ABM clients, from invoice creation to distribution. In this role, you will develop a solid understanding of ABM business model while handling a high volume of transactions, working directly with internal and external clients to ensure their billing needs are addressed. This is a key role within the Quote-to-Cash group. Ability to learn quickly and adapt is fundamental to the success of this role.

      Essential Functions:

      • Ensure invoicing is done accurately and timely for the portfolio of business under your responsibility, which includes but is not limited to:
        • Entry level biller : Tag or Fixed-Fee bill types
        • Generate invoices from our work order system or from BUS (Billing Utility System)
        • Review invoices for accuracy and process invoices in designated ERP system
        • Delivery of invoices to client via email, portal upload, or snail mail
        • Process credit memos and/or credit & rebills as required for invoice revisions
      • Effectively communicate with Operations with intention to answer questions regarding revenue and resolve/notify of billing issues and exceptions that could prevent from an accurate and timely invoice to the clients
      • Research billing issues by going through prior period invoices, and reaching out to various players within the company to help resolve discrepancies
      • Retrieve various billing documents & support needed for quarterly audits
      • Daily monitoring of ServiceNow portal for various ticket requests issued to the assigned billing team
      • Ad-hoc projects, as needed

      ABM Industries Inc. is a facility management provider in the United States. Founded in 1909 by Morris Rosenberg in San Francisco, California, as a window washing business. ABM provides facility services in areas such as electrical and lighting, energy, facility engineering, HVAC and mechanical, janitorial services, landscape and grounds, parking and transportation. ABM's services also include energy efficiency and sustainability such as building improvements, electric vehicle charging stations, and renewable energy solutions.
